  • Page 2 All specifications are subject to change without notice ATTENTION The product that you have purchased contains a rechargeable Ni-MH battery. This battery is recyclable. At the end of its useful life, under various state and local laws, it may be illegal to dispose of the battery into the municipal waste system. Check with your local solid waste officials for details concerning recycling options or proper disposal WARNING This is a Class A product.

  • Page 72: Overview

    Table Management and Clerk Interrupt Operations Overview The ER-5200 series can employ a manual previous balance, hard check, or soft check system. (You must select hard or soft check posting in memory allocation programming - the default selection is soft.) There are two methods in ER-52xx series to manage check track.

  • Page 98: Tax Programming

    Tax Programming The ER-5200/15/40 has the capability to support four separate taxes. Taxes can be calculated as either a straight percentage rate of between .001% and 99.999%, or a 60 break point tax table. Each tax may be either an add-on tax (added to the cost of a taxable item), or a value added tax (VAT) that is included in the price of the item.
